首页 游戏攻略 正文

电脑怎么设置模拟键盘功能?详细教程新手也能快速掌握!

说起来,今天这个分享,完全是被逼出来的。大家知道,我这个人平日里最讨厌重复性工作,简直是浪费生命。偏偏前段时间,我接手了一个老项目的数据维护工作,每天都要在几个窗口里来回切换,输入固定的几个指令和参数,一天下来,手都快抽筋了。那种机械、枯燥的感觉,让我实在受不了。

第一次尝试:徒手硬扛,宣告失败

刚开始,我硬着头皮自己干,想着忍一忍就过去了。但是人不是机器,你按键按得快了,系统反馈慢了,就会漏掉;按慢了,整个进度又拖沓。更要命的是,我发现自己每天总有那么三五次,会把一个参数中的数字按错,导致整个批次都要回炉重造。那段时间,我简直是心力交瘁,效率低得可怕。

我当时就琢磨,电脑自己能跑程序,为啥不能让它自己把这些按键给按了?这就是我开始研究“模拟键盘”功能的最初动力。

明确目标:我要的不是宏,而是“灵魂附体”

我的需求很明确,不是那种简单的游戏宏(就是长按一个键发射一堆技能那种),我要的是一个能完全模拟我操作逻辑的程序:

电脑怎么设置模拟键盘功能?详细教程新手也能快速掌握!

  • 第一步:点击窗口A,确保它在前台。

  • 第二步:输入一串固定的账号和密码(模拟登录)。

  • 第三步:输入指令集1,并等待系统响应(这个等待时间必须可控)。

  • 第四步:切换到窗口B,执行指令集2。

  • 第五步:循环往复。

我问了一圈搞技术的朋友,他们给我推荐了一个非常趁手的小工具。我这里不提名字,但我会告诉大家它的原理,非常简单,新手也能立马搞懂。

实践过程:从零开始配置我的“虚拟助手”

我下载并安装了这个小工具后,发现它的核心功能,就是让你写一个简单的“剧本”。这个剧本就是告诉电脑,你下一步要做什么。

第一阶段:摸索与编写剧本(配置档)

这个工具的操作逻辑是基于文本的。我需要创建一个纯文本文件,里面写满指令。

1. 定义热键启动:

我得给这个“剧本”安排一个启动键。我选择了F10。这样,当我把窗口准备好后,按一下F10,它就开始干活了。

2. 模拟按键和延时:

我发现,最关键的指令就是“发送按键”和“暂停”。因为电脑执行速度太快,如果指令连着发,系统根本反应不过来,就会出错。

我最初的尝试非常粗糙,就像这样:

Send, username
Send, {Tab}
Send, password
Send, {Enter}

结果,系统只输入了一半,卡住了。我意识到,必须加入延时。

3. 引入停顿(Delay):

我开始在每一步操作之间插入延时命令。延时是以毫秒计算的,我一开始设了100毫秒(Wait, 100),发现太短;我根据系统的响应速度,把登录这一块的延时定在了500毫秒,也就是半秒。

Send, username
Wait, 500
Send, {Tab}
Wait, 500
Send, password
Wait, 1000 ; 登录后系统加载需要更久,所以停顿1秒

这个过程就是反复测试,不断调整延时的数值,直到操作顺滑为止。这才是最花时间,但也最有趣的部分。

第二阶段:实现窗口切换和精准输入

光输入可不够,我的任务需要在两个不同窗口之间切换。我发现这个工具还有个神器的功能,就是能指定某个窗口进行操作。

1. 激活窗口:

我通过抓取目标窗口的标题,让程序能“精准定位”。例如,我告诉它:

WinActivate, 目标数据录入系统A

一旦这个窗口被激活,接下来的按键指令就只会发送给它,不会干扰到我正在看的其他网页。

2. 自动化循环:

因为我的任务是重复性的,我利用了工具的循环命令。我设定了一个计数器,让它循环执行刚才那一套“登录-输入-退出”的流程,重复一百次。我只需要启动一次,剩下的时间我就能去喝茶看文件了。

最终效果:一次性解放双手

整个配置档我折腾了大概一个下午,主要时间都花在调整延时和确保窗口切换的稳定性上。但当我在电脑前,眼睁睁看着F10一按下去,电脑自己开始像被施了魔法一样,准确无误地完成所有复杂的输入和切换操作时,那种感觉,简直太棒了。

我每天只需要花五分钟启动这个脚本,剩下的时间,原本要枯燥输入两三个小时的工作,都交给我的“虚拟助手”了。我这才能抽出时间,好好写写这些实践记录分享给大伙儿。

所以说,如果你也有大量重复的按键输入工作,别硬扛着了。花点时间找个靠谱的模拟键盘工具,写个简单的“剧本”,绝对能让你事半功倍,把宝贵的精力用在真正需要思考的地方。

相关推荐